Examining Dirt Problems and Drainage
As you begin your task, evaluating soil conditions and drainage is important for the success of your retaining wall. Sandy dirt drains pipes well however does not have security, while clay dirt can retain wetness, leading to push on your wall.
Next, analyze the slope of your backyard. If water naturally streams towards your wall surface, you'll need to apply a drainage solution to avoid erosion and pressure buildup. Take into consideration setting up perforated pipelines or gravel backfill behind the wall surface to help with drain.
Lastly, observe any close-by trees or plant life; their origins can impact soil security. By comprehending your soil conditions and carrying out correct water drainage, you'll develop a solid structure for your retaining wall that stands the test of time.

Determining Elevation and Density Demands
To build a strong retaining wall, you require to precisely calculate its elevation and density needs based upon the our website dirt problems and the elevation of the slope it will certainly support. Begin by examining the incline's angle and the sort of dirt, as different soils put in varying quantities of pressure.
For walls over 4 feet high, take into consideration a thickness of a minimum of 12 inches. If the wall is taller, boost the thickness proportionally to keep stability.
Following, compute the height of the wall by determining the upright distance it requires to preserve. For each foot of elevation, you must typically intend for a density of one-third of the wall's elevation.
Always bear in mind to make up added aspects like drainage and backfill, which can affect your wall surface's style. Correct computations currently ensure your retaining wall stands solid and lasts for several years to come.
Maintenance and Durability Considerations
While maintaining your retaining wall may look like a reduced concern, disregarding it can cause substantial issues in time. Regular inspections are important; look for fractures, bulges, or any indicators of water damage. Dealing with these troubles early can save you from costly repairs later on.
Watch on water drainage systems, also. Clogged drains pipes can create water to accumulate, exerting stress on your wall and jeopardizing its stability. Clear particles and warranty proper flow to keep durability.
You might likewise desire to assess sealing your wall to secure it from moisture and weathering. Relying on the material, this could call for reapplication every couple of years.
Finally, landscape design around your wall can sustain its honesty. Prevent growing big trees close by, as their roots can threaten the foundation. With positive maintenance, your retaining wall surface can offer you well for years to come.
